Celtic supporters have been scathing on social media in their reaction to the news that former Rangers manager Walter Smith has pulled out of the running to become next Scotland manager.
The news was reported by Superscoreboard’s Twitter account, who reported that the one time Scotland boss held talks with the SFA but decided against taking the job once again.
Walter Smith no longer in the running to become next Scotland manager.
The 69-year-old held talks with SFA but has decided against returning to the Scotland setup.

The SFA do not have their problems to seek, as not only does their search for a new manager continue but they are without a chief executive following the departure of Stewart Regan.
Hoops fans can now turn their attention back to matters on the pitch, as the Bhoys aim to bounce back from their 1-0 loss to Kilmarnock in the Scottish Cup tie against Partick Thistle.
A win over the Jags would see the Hoops only three games away from completing an unprecedented second consecutive domestic treble.
